簡體   English   中英

Mysql復制不能與其他數據庫引擎一起使用?

[英]Mysql replication does not work with different db engines?

我們正在將1db復制到其他群集,但不是在復制所有表。 我不知道是什么問題。 它始終顯示復制狀態為同步。

當前,復制僅適用於InnoDB存儲引擎。 不會復制任何其他類型的表,包括系統(mysql。 )表(此限制不包括DDL語句,例如CREATE USER,它隱式修改mysql。表-已復制)。 但是,有針對MyISAM的實驗性支持-請參見wsrep_replicate_myisam系統變量)

參考鏈接

如果您將innodb用作默認數據庫引擎,則將innodb與所有表一起使用。

原因可能是:

ALTER TABLE tableName ENGINE = InnoDB;

您可以通過這種方式進行修復。 在主服務器上運行以上命令。

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M